CDKING, this would be a very good and the most convenient option, but unfortunately only in theory. In reality Chinese authorities are trying to downplay Hainan VOA in favor of Hainan 30 day visa free access. I would say that Hainan VOA is practically on the exit doors. Here on this forum, on Hainan 30 day visa free access, there is a post by 3 UK citizens, published today, who had their tickets to Hainan from Singapore. They were denied boarding because the Singaporean immigration authorities demanded the proof of Chinese authorities approval for their day visa free access. Simply speaking, they were not allowed to travel to Hainan and they intended to use exactly Hainan VOA.
Having the above mentioned in mind, I would suggest to Kathy to obtain a single entry Chinese tourist (L) visa in advance because there are more and more testimonies showing that Hainan VOA is more like a roulette and less like a reliable option of travel to Hainan.
